Atlanta police are looking for several suspects who swiped a cash machine from a Lakewood Avenue Family Dollar store early Tuesday.

Officers responded to a 5:30 a.m. alarm call at the Family Dollar on Lakewood Avenue near Metropolitan Parkway.

“Upon arrival, they discovered that the front doors had been pried open and the small ATM machine just inside the front doors was missing from the location,” Atlanta police Capt. Scott Kreher told The Atlanta Journal-Constitution.

Kreher said security video showed that five or six males “fully dressed out with hoodies and gloves” got out of a blue Chrysler minivan, pried the front doors open, removed the ATM and left in the minivan.

“They were in and out in about a minute,” Kreher said. “It didn’t take them long at all.”
